Default Updated: Cranks, Fires then Dies

"94 Civic EX .... Engine stopped running, would crank and would fire while the
ignition was engaged, but when starter disengaged it stopped firing. It started 15min later and I went home. The next day, it started and stopped running 10mi from home just like the night before. As before, it would fire while the starter was engaged but would stop firing immediately when I
backed off on the key thereby disengaging the starter. This time it would not start and I had it towed back home. Today as I was attempting get it mobile,
I noticed that none of my dash lights came on when I turned on the ignition.
It continues to crank and fire only when the starter is engaged only. I put in a new coil to no avail. The battery has been freshly charged.
Any ideas anyone? I'd greatly appreciate all input. Thanks, David.
